The Importance Of A Behaviour Coach In Personal Development

In today’s fast-paced world, many individuals struggle with various aspects of their lives, such as stress, anxiety, low self-esteem, or negative habits. This is where a behaviour coach can make a significant difference. A behaviour coach is a professional who helps individuals identify their goals, create actionable plans, and develop positive habits to achieve personal growth and success.

One of the most important roles of a behaviour coach is to help individuals gain self-awareness. Self-awareness is crucial for personal development because it allows individuals to recognize their strengths and weaknesses, understand their emotions and reactions, and identify areas for improvement. A behaviour coach can work with clients to explore their thoughts, beliefs, and values, and help them uncover underlying patterns that may be holding them back from reaching their full potential.

Another key aspect of a behaviour coach’s role is to assist clients in setting meaningful goals. Goals provide individuals with direction and motivation, and they help them measure their progress and celebrate their achievements. A behaviour coach can help clients set realistic, achievable goals that align with their values and aspirations, and break them down into manageable steps. By guiding clients in creating specific, measurable, and time-bound goals, a behaviour coach can help them stay focused and accountable throughout their personal development journey.

Furthermore, a behaviour coach can help individuals develop positive habits and routines. Habits play a significant role in shaping our behaviour and influencing our success. A behaviour coach can work with clients to identify unhealthy habits that may be hindering their progress and support them in replacing them with positive habits that support their goals. By helping clients establish consistent routines and practice new behaviours, a behaviour coach can empower them to make lasting changes that lead to personal growth and fulfillment.

Moreover, a behaviour coach can provide valuable feedback and guidance to clients as they navigate challenging situations and obstacles. Life is full of ups and downs, and setbacks are a natural part of the personal development journey. A behaviour coach can serve as a supportive ally, offering a fresh perspective, encouragement, and constructive criticism to help clients overcome obstacles and stay motivated. With their knowledge and expertise, a behaviour coach can help clients develop resilience, adaptability, and problem-solving skills to navigate life’s challenges with confidence and grace.

In addition, a behaviour coach can help individuals improve their interpersonal skills and enhance their relationships. Our interactions with others play a significant role in our personal and professional success. A behaviour coach can help clients build effective communication skills, resolve conflicts, and cultivate meaningful connections with others. By fostering empathy, active listening, and assertiveness, a behaviour coach can help clients navigate social situations with ease and build strong, supportive relationships that contribute to their overall well-being and success.
